The Anglers Museum; or, the Whole Art of Float and Fly Fishing
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ating print that takes us back to the 18th century. This engraving, part of the Stapleton Collection, showcases a portrait of John Kirby, an esteemed angler of his time. As we gaze upon this image, we are transported into the world of fishing - a timeless pursuit that connects man with nature's wonders. The book in Kirby's hands represents his vast knowledge and expertise in float and fly fishing techniques.
